Output e8489c8a89760d5c3d254d41ee4672d203ea3ace754392b85945bcc50f299fbd:0

value
197553
script pubkey
OP_0 OP_PUSHBYTES_20 a588fa8100aff3329e5ea10134656d2bece361f4
address
bc1q5ky04qgq4len98j75yqngetd90kwxc05txvflk
transaction
e8489c8a89760d5c3d254d41ee4672d203ea3ace754392b85945bcc50f299fbd
confirmations
38849
spent
true